What is the Definition of Happiness? A Biblical Perspective
Happiness is a state of well-being that is characterized by a relative permanence of emotion ranging from mere contentment to deep and intense joy in living. It differs from mere pleasure, which may come about simply through chance contact and stimulation. In the Bible, God is described as the happiest and most joyful being, as He is the source of all human and cosmic happiness.
God as the Happiest Person in the Bible
According to the Bible, God Almighty is the happiest person. The New Testament book 1 Timothy 1:11 describes Him as the “happy God.” This divine joy is not just limited to the spiritual realm but also encompasses a deep and fulfilling existence.
For God, Joy Is in Giving
The Son of God, Jesus, put it best when He declared, “There is more happiness in giving than there is in receiving” (Acts 20:35). This concept is further emphasized by the example of our heavenly Father, who is the most exemplary in giving. Let's explore why this statement holds such profound significance.

Ways in Which God Brings Joy
Life’s Necessities and Pleasures: God maintains life in numerous ways. Psalm 104:15 says, “You give us wine that makes happy hearts. And you give us olive oil that makes our faces shine. You give us bread that gives us strength.” This verse highlights how God provides not only the basic necessities of life but also the pleasures that bring joy and fulfillment.
Guidance and Peace: God offers us emotional well-being and a wonderful future. In Romans 15:13, it’s stated, “May the God who gives us hope fill you with all joy and peace as you trust in him.” This verse underscores the ongoing source of joy that God provides, both here and in the future.
Existence and Purpose: God maintains that “he gives you rain from heaven, and crops in their season; he provides food and fills your hearts with joy and good_gifts” (Acts 14:17). This passage highlights the abundant blessings and joy that come from God’s provision.
